Output 74022635a63671529ff3c154b67166e476c843483c551d992ef5682be8335a5a:0

value
51033
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cddee6495eeb7c6d8a46b6e6b84721f7db23111f5a6b7a10a41a715066879851
address
bc1peh0wvj27ad7xmzjxkmnts3ep7ldjxygltf4h5y9yrfc4qe58npgsuq9yfq
transaction
74022635a63671529ff3c154b67166e476c843483c551d992ef5682be8335a5a
spent
true